Target Background

Function
Probable ubiquitin-protein ligase involved in pre-mRNA splicing. Acts as a central component of the NTC complex (or PRP19-associated complex) that associates to the spliceosome to mediate conformational rearrangement or to stabilize the structure of the spliceosome after U4 snRNA dissociation, which leads to spliceosome maturation. It is also probably involved in DNA repair.
Gene References into Functions
  1. we provide the first piece of evidence that the linker sequences outside the RNA recognition motif (RRM) - those connecting the ZnF domain and the RRM of the Prp19-associated complex - directly interact with RNA PMID: 21957909
  2. New low abundance splicing factors connected to NTC (Nineteen Complex) function, provides evidence for distinct Prp19 containing complexes, and underscores the role of the Prp19 WD40 domain as a splicing scaffold. PMID: 21386897
  3. hPRP19 interacts with PHD3 to suppress the cell death under hypoxic conditions by limiting the function of PHD3 which leads to caspase activation PMID: 20599946
  4. Prp19p forms a tetramer in vitro and in vivo; the domain required for its oligomerization maps to a central tetrameric coiled-coil PMID: 15601865
  5. Data suggest that the Prp19-associated complex is required for defining the specificity of interaction of U5 and U6 with the 5' splice site to stabilize their association with the spliceosome after U4 is dissociated. PMID: 15994330
  6. The Prp19-associated complex has an indirect role in spliceosome recycling through affecting the biogenesis of U4/U6 snRNP in the in vivo splicing reaction. PMID: 16540691
  7. Yju2 acts in concert with an unidentified heat-resistant factor(s) in an ATP-independent manner to promote the first catalytic reaction of pre-mRNA splicing after Prp2-mediated structural rearrangement of the spliceosome. PMID: 17515604
